EAST COAST IVML SERVICE M"ESSRS JONES, SCOTT AND CO beg to notify the residents of Masterton, and settlers of the East ast that they have taken over the ov mail service, go long conducted I* .essrs Pin-hoy Bros., and they ust by courtesy and strict attention business, s merit a continuance of their support. Coaches run as follows: FROM MASTERTON. Tinui, Whakataki, and Castlepoint: Every Monday, Wednesday, and Frileaving Masterton at 7.45 a.m. Homewood : Every Tuesday and Frileaving Masterton at 8.30 a.m. Stronvar: Every Monday and Thursday, leaving Masterton at 7 a.m. SEATS can be booked at the stables during the day up till 6 p.m., and in the evening from 8 till o'clock. Patrons please nyte that all luggage and parcels for delivery must be left at our Coaching Stables, at the rear of Mr Eton's Pharmacy. JONES, SCOTT AND CO, Proprietors, Masterton, Telephone 130.
